In-Text But that same comforter of whome I haue made so muche mencion vnto you, I meane the holy goost, whose feate and offyce shal be to sanctifye & lyghten you vnto all trouth, which holy goost my father shall sende in my name that is to saye for my cause, he shall teach you altogether & shall put you in remembraunce of all that euer ye haue herde of me.
